Output 1085a8c14b186ac41d6b0ba0afc072d6a0a1b2735cbe4b63165e9241d012b81b:18

value
1252673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4b9d798504934f1d46919cbc3aec1ce9c425e7 OP_EQUAL
address
3MbFpCEZwbtbYutEzskvKoRkSqQ513C4JM
transaction
1085a8c14b186ac41d6b0ba0afc072d6a0a1b2735cbe4b63165e9241d012b81b
confirmations
133548
spent
true